Had a tiger eye change to red in a shank repair, luckily the customer liked it better and did not want it replaced even though I had one and offered to do it for free. Who'd a thunk that?
I believe I have read that the red and blue versions of tiger eye
and pietersite are heated (either by man or mother nature) to get
those colors from what starts out the usual yellow. So I suppose it’s
to be expected.
